Overstreet 38. Price movement thread.

111 posts in this topic

I thought maybe we could have a thread just devoted to what went up and down and everyone could chime in with what they've noticed.

 

So far, the biggest increase I've seen is for Uncle Scrooge #1 (and other early issues) which was a real surprise. About 3-4 years ago Overstreet actually nudged these prices down and suddenly a giant increase. Something like 30% across all grades for #1.

 

I saw good sized increases for Lois Lane #1 (almost 7%) and decent for JLA #1 (4% or so).

 

Iron Man #1 down almost 10%? WTH? So I'm wondering if there are other decreases that are strange. (Stranger than seeing Rawhide go down almost 10%.)

 

Of course I'm also seeing random moves that always make one wonder about the methodology too. Like some early WDCS going up 10% while others only a few years later and still hard to stock go down 5%. Seems really weird.

Incredible Hulk 181 up $50 in NM-, untouched in low-grade. Early Hulks up 5%.

 

Batman 200 up a smidge in high grade, down a touch in low-grade.

 

My vote for insane price change of the year so far: Batman 100 is one I consider way overpriced. I sometimes see this book for about 40% off with no takers. So this year it goes from $514 in VG to $552! Crazy.

 

I feel the same way about Superman 100 and it went up 5% this year too.

My god, they've taken an axe to Pogo Possum! These books went down in last year's guide and then this year we're talking down 25% for some books.

 

So nobody should say that books only go up.

 

I'm getting the feeling that there are a lot of surprises and a lot of movement in this edition.
